Chaupra is an inhabited village in Shahnagar Sub-district of Panna district, Madhya Pradesh. Its Census village code is 459402, the Census 2011 record lists 1,613 people in 357 households and the reported area is 730.35 hectares. The local references include Shahnagar CD Block and the nearest town reference is Katni at about 35 km.
